Aims

The theme of this event is 'collaboration' and participants will explore four linked themes:

* Collaborative leadership: Leaders as 'boundary spanners' and co-ordinators

* Collaborative practice in professional development: sharing current challenges and new ideas in faculty development

* Exploring issues emerging for the community and sharing good practice

* Writing collaboratively and developing your publication strategy

Facilitator background

The workshop will be led by Judy McKimm, Nigel Purcell and Faith Hill (with other colleagues) founded and have led the MEDEV series of leadership in education events since their inception in 2006.

Judy McKimm is Visiting Professor in Healthcare Education and Leadership at the University of Bedfordshire. She is an experienced educator who has primarily worked in health professions' education and faculty development. She has managed a number of high profile, national projects in leadership development and the higher education response to the children's service agenda.

Dr Faith Hill is Director of the Division of Medical Education at the University of Southampton. Faith leads a highly successful programme of staff development for over 2,000 clinical and academic teachers throughout the South Central NHS Region. She has over 50 publications on health and education and has run a variety of workshops at major national and international education conferences. Faith was awarded a National Teaching Fellowship from the Higher Education Academy earlier this year.'

Nigel Purcell is a Senior Education Advisor at the MEDEV subject centre and has considerable experience of faculty and education development in the field of health care education. Nigel is also an Accreditor for the Higher Education Academy.
